Long is not the same as thick

These get treated as one problem and they are two. Density is how many hairs you have; length is how long each one is. You can have fine, sparse hair to your waist or a dense head cropped to the jaw.

Your ends are the oldest hair you own

Hair grows at roughly half an inch a month, so hair past the shoulder blades has tips that have been on your head for two years or more — through every wash, every brush and every previous styling session.

That is measurable rather than metaphorical. Researchers cutting hair into segments from root to tip found that concentrations of free polar lipids and covalently bound fatty acids decreased steadily along the fiber, with a significant reduction in tensile properties across the same span — Duvel et al., International Journal of Cosmetic Science.

Two free adjustments follow. Drop a step on the lengths if your tool has one. And never go back over the ends to fix a section — a repeat pass on the weakest hair you own is the worst trade available. Why splits form where they do is on the split ends page.

Section count is the number to attack

Everything here reduces to one arithmetic. If a wide plate lets you do thirty sections instead of forty-five, that is fifteen fewer heat applications every time you style — repeated across a year it dwarfs any difference between 365°F and 380°F.

The other lever is free: section properly before you start. Sections thicker than about an inch have hair in the middle that never contacts the tool, stays unstyled, and sends you back over it — the method.

The other thing length changes

Weight, and not just the tool’s. A curl in long hair is fighting gravity from the moment you release it, which is why long-haired people so often conclude their curls do not hold.

Two fixes. Let each curl cool completely before it takes any weight — pinning it to your head while it cools is the classic technique for exactly this. And go one step tighter than the finished look you want, because a curl in long hair relaxes further than the same curl in short hair. The full version is on why curls drop.

Twelve ounces does not sound like much until you hold it at shoulder height for twenty-five minutes. 16.6 oz is 1.04 lb against the Dyson Supersonic’s published 1.8 lb, and on the hair length with the longest sessions that gap is the argument.

The 9 ft cord is joint longest in our registry and it earns its keep here specifically — long hair means working right around the back of your head, section by section.

Five heat and three speed settings lets you run the lengths cooler than the roots, which on long hair is not a refinement.

Plate width is what reduces section count, and section count is what drives total heat exposure on a lot of hair. A wider plate covers more per stroke, which means fewer separate heat applications across the same head.

Floating ceramic plates with a re-engineered wishbone hinge to hold them aligned — alignment being what stops a wide plate gripping unevenly across a long section.

Barrel length is the specification long hair needs and almost nobody publishes. More barrel means more hair per wrap, which means fewer sections and fewer heat applications.

Choose the diameter with the published weight in front of you: 10.6 oz at 1 in, 13.2 oz at 1.25 in, 15.1 oz at 1.5 in, cord not included. That is 42 percent heavier at the top.

Nine heat settings lets you drop a step for the ends, and genuine 100–240 V auto world voltage means it travels.

A paddle covers more hair per stroke than a round barrel — the same coverage arithmetic as plate width on an iron.

The swivel cord matters more here than at any other length. Long hair means many strokes, each with a rotation, and accumulated twist in a fixed cord becomes a kink that fights you.

An excellent tool doing the wrong job. It wins the short-hair page, it is the only genuine clipless wand we cover, and it publishes universal voltage.

On long hair the half-inch diameter works against you twice. It wraps the least hair per pass, so you do the most sections and apply the most heat across the head. And it produces a ringlet, which on long hair drops under its own weight faster than a looser curl does.

If you want tight curls on long hair you will be there a while with any tool, and this one longest.

Questions people actually ask

What hair tools are best for long hair?

Ones that cover the most hair per pass and weigh the least. Plate width, barrel length and tool weight matter more than wattage, because long hair is a section-count problem rather than a power problem.

Is long hair the same as thick hair for choosing tools?

No. Density is how many hairs you have; length is how long each is. Thick hair needs power and plate contact; long hair needs low weight, a long cord and coverage per pass.

Why do the ends of long hair get damaged first?

Because they are the oldest part. Lipid content and tensile strength both decrease measurably from root to tip, so the setting that is fine at your mid-lengths is being applied to hair with less structure.
